Adobe.com
Contents Suites Classes Class Index Member Index

AIToolboxMessage Struct Reference

The contents of a toolbox message. More...

#include <AIToolbox.h>

List of all members.

Public Attributes

SPMessageData d = {}
 The message data.
AIToolboxHandle toolbox = {}
 The toolbox reference.
AIToolType tool = 0
 The tool reference.
AIDataStackRef iconResourceDictionary
 The icon shown in the Tools palette.
char * name = nullptr
 Unique identifying name for the tool.
char * title_deprecated = nullptr
 This is a deprecated field and will only be filled with an empty string.
char * tooltip_deprecated = nullptr
 This is a deprecated field and will only be filled with an empty string.
ASHelpID helpID_deprecated = 0
 This is a deprecated field and will not be used.
ai::IconType iconType = ai::IconType::kInvalid
AIToolType sameGroupAs = 0
 This is for internal purpose only to hold plugin's priority for group.
AIToolType sameSetAs = 0
 This is for internal purpose only to hold plugin's priority for set.
bool isThirdPartyPlugin = false
 This is for internal purpose only to hold a plugin is third party plugin or not.
ai::UnicodeString title
 Localized display name for the tool.
ai::UnicodeString tooltip
 Short descriptive string shown when tool is activated.

Detailed Description

The contents of a toolbox message.

Valid fields depend on the selector type.


Member Data Documentation

The message data.

This is a deprecated field and will not be used.

The icon shown in the Tools palette.

ai::IconType AIToolboxMessage::iconType = ai::IconType::kInvalid

This is for internal purpose only to hold a plugin is third party plugin or not.

char* AIToolboxMessage::name = nullptr

Unique identifying name for the tool.

This is for internal purpose only to hold plugin's priority for group.

This is for internal purpose only to hold plugin's priority for set.

Localized display name for the tool.

This is a deprecated field and will only be filled with an empty string.

The tool reference.

The toolbox reference.

Short descriptive string shown when tool is activated.

This is a deprecated field and will only be filled with an empty string.


The documentation for this struct was generated from the following file:


Contents Suites Classes Class Index Member Index
Adobe Solutions Network
 
Copyright © 2014 Adobe Systems Incorporated. All rights reserved.
Terms of Use Online Privacy Policy Adobe and accessibility Avoid software piracy Permissions and Trademarks